Basic copy operations

Scanning a multi-page document from the original glass

When making double-sided or combined copies using the original glass, place each page of a multi-page
document on the original glass to scan it. The following procedure describes how to place single-sided
document pages on the original glass to make double-sided copies.
0
The output method used with the "Separate Scan" setting can be set to "Page Print" or "Batch Print".
As a default, "Page Print" is selected.
0
For details on the output method used with the "Separate Scan" setting, refer to "Copier Settings" on
page 11-18.
1
Lift open the ADF.
2
Position the first page or the first side of the document face down onto the original glass.
For details on positioning the document, refer to "Placing the document on the original glass" on
page 2-7.
3
Close the ADF.
4
In the Basic screen, touch [Duplex/Combine].
The Duplex/Combine screen appears.
